当前位置: 首页 > 面试经验 >

快手前凉经

优质
小牛编辑
127浏览
2023-03-28

快手前凉经

一面

一面其实是抱着反正过不了无所谓的心态面的,可能反而因此表现得还好,答了80%吧。面试官人很好,你不会会给你讲解,体验很棒。
  1. 你对react都了解哪些hooks,答了useState(),useEffect,useContext,useRef,面试官讲解了useEffect的作用,然后追问useEffect第二个参数为空数组的效果
  2. 为什么会提出函数组件,主要是解决什么问题
  3. ES6有哪些了解,列举了几个,然后追问了会不会promise,然后回答了js运行机制
  4. 给了一道this题,看代码说结果,然后答错了,面试官把这个知识点又仔细讲了一遍
  5. CSS 如何实现两栏布局
  6. flex的三个参数,flex:1是什么意思,flex:2呢
  7. 其他的不太记得了,都是基础知识,大概45分钟
  8. 算法:如何把123456变成123,456 , js写函数,写的时候面试官也有提示思路可以反转,不过还是按自己想法从左到右写了,代码确实冗余不少

二面

一面过了,二面就特想进,贪了贪了,自我介绍完就越来越紧张,不由自主地挠头,估计是凉凉了。
不过面试官很友善地和我交流,问了五道题,每道题都会给我讲解思路,但是一道不会就道道不会,debuff叠满了,不过面试官会给你提示,给你意见,非常感谢
下面的问题是由我的简历上的内容提出的,我前端的项目经验太少了,所以写了一些别的
  1. 你的爬虫是怎么实现的?你如何用爬虫去获取一个页面所有的url  ,答了自己是调包,然后存储url,答得不太好,开始紧张了
  2. 你的demo里有讲到组件库的轮播图,你可以不借助库,简单讲一下轮播图的html和css如何写吗  ,用轻雀的代码工具 用js在那写伪代码,代码风格一塌糊涂,勉勉强强讲了大概思路,
  3. 可以讲一下表单联动是怎么实现吗,给了一个例子?这个没听清题,先用css讲了思路,但是面试官要js,然后说要先处理数据格式,然后就是面试官再讲了。这个时候已经开始慌了
  4. 你说你做过echarts,给了一个k-means的分类图片,问怎么用html,css,js实现这个分类图。这里提示了还是先看数据类型,然后把圆点渲染,然后需要获取边界,这一步我完全瞎编了,在那试,最后获取到边界,用css剪裁。最后面试官讲解了这个该怎么做。说数据格式很重要,然后写个js函数去获取边界。这个时候我已经慌得不行了
  5. 因为你说你要做知识图谱,那么问一个简单的图的算法吧。如何判断一个图是否是有向无环图?例  [[1,0],[0,1]]  ,直接提示了这个可以用dfs,然后我这个时候已经不能冷静思考了,写到最后也写的很乱,没写出来。面试官最后又提示了dfs该怎么写。当天晚上睡觉脑子里都是dfs,还是太菜了
估计二面是要凉了,研二菜鸡,啥也不会。寒假开始学的前端,也没什么项目经验,只准备了基础知识和八股,自己完成了一个简单的react小demo:https://github.com/Brandy2333/HKZF_React,别的就没有项目经验了。
太菜了属实。面试官也给了学习的建议,也发现了自己的不足,继续加油吧。
不过大厂的面试官确实水平很高,会引导思考。
 类似资料: